Insurance & Accessibility

Direct billing may be available through TELUS eClaims for eligible insurance plans. Insurer-ready receipts are also provided for reimbursement/self-submission where direct billing is not available. Please confirm coverage eligibility with your provider for services under the designations

  • Canadian Certified Counsellor – CCC #11248255
  • Counselling Therapist – ACTA #2817 (Alberta)
  • Registered Clinical Counsellor – BCACC #22698 (British Columbia)

Hi, I’m Anjali. I offer an integrative, insurance-friendly blend of Clinical Counselling, Clinical Hypnotherapy, and trauma-aware mind–body practices. My work brings together traditional therapy with holistic tools like Breathwork, Meditation Coaching, and Bach Flower Remedies — chosen with care, clarity, and respect.

I moved to Canada in 2023 and have been working steadily to build a space where care feels ethical, accessible, and whole. I believe support should honour the full complexity of who we are — not just what’s hurting, but also what’s trying to grow.

I’m in ongoing supervision and in therapy myself, committed to doing the inner work that allows me to show up fully for others. I practice with presence, humility, and a deep respect for your pace.
